Here is a soft key holder design.
The key holder uses a flexible part that is "counter intuitive" rather than deforming downwards it deforms upwards to be able to hold the keys.
The flexible wire is 82A

3D printing settings
For the base:
Printer use: Artillery Sidewinder X1
Thread to use: PETG Sunlu
Extruder temperature: 250°.
Bed temperature: 60°.
Filling: 60%.
Accuracy: 0.2 mm
Layer height: 0.2 mm
Speed: 70 mm/s
Slicer: Cura 4.8.0
For the flexible part:
Printer to use: Artillery Sidewinder X1
Thread to use: Recreus FilaFlex 82A
Extruder temperature: 230°.
Bed temperature: 0° C
Filling: 100%.
Accuracy: 0.2 mm
Layer height: 0.2 mm
Speed: 25 mm/s
Slicer: Cura 4.8.0
